Output 296397ca23d7578128519d358db442a66bd5697f8e423a0bc59b426bcbf50396:7

value
93303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89b72facc75fa27692e4d2b86a5073f6b53d320 OP_EQUAL
address
3KyjHhsCFz3tjPAkjQC28CCdnMrsGkjRwT
transaction
296397ca23d7578128519d358db442a66bd5697f8e423a0bc59b426bcbf50396
spent
true